应用程序请求弹出筛选用户


app application request popup filter users

是否可以在FB.ui弹出窗口中只邀请女孩加入我的应用程序?

谢谢你的任何建议,如果没有,也许还有其他解决方案?

用户在应用程序中。有一个邀请朋友按钮与jscode:

 $('#btnInvite').bind("click", function(){
        FB.ui({method:'apprequests',title:'test',message:'test',data:'test'});
    })

然后弹出与朋友似乎被选中。是否可以仅对女性用户筛选此列表(应用程序专用于女孩)

是的,这是可行的。

然而,你将不得不经历一些额外的困难才能完成它。

发件人:https://developers.facebook.com/docs/reference/dialogs/requests/,你可以看到,你可以指定应用程序发送到的朋友ID列表。

发件人https://developers.facebook.com/docs/reference/api/user/#friends,您可以获得朋友列表。寻找雌性。或者您可以使用https://developers.facebook.com/docs/reference/fql/user/寻找女性朋友fql?q=SELECT uid, name, sex FROM user WHERE uid IN (SELECT uid1 FROM friend WHERE uid2=me()) and sex="female"

将女性朋友列表呈现给用户,让用户选择哪些朋友。

将选定的女性朋友ID连接在一起,并将其传递给https://developers.facebook.com/docs/reference/dialogs/requests/请求对话框的to字段。

勒沃伊拉!Finis!:)